House Bill 2963
By Delegate Young
[Introduced January 24, 2023; Referred to the Committee on Banking and Insurance then the Judiciary]
A BILL to amend the Code of West Virginia, 1931, as amended, by adding thereto a new article, designated §25-8-1, relating to inmate medical or dental co-payments.
Be it enacted by the Legislature of West Virginia:
No rehabilitation center operating in the State of West Virginia under the jurisdiction of the Division of Corrections and Rehabilitation, including adult and juvenile centers, shall assess an inmate any co-payment fee for medical or dental services.
NOTE: The purpose of this bill is to prohibit the assessment of co-payments for medical or dental services by correctional facilities in the State of West Virginia.
